Putting together a little mix of mutant disco past and present, or something like it, and the thread running through it seems to be percussion lines based on rattling congas (often, with cowbell and handclaps) -- sometimes clean and lithe, sometimes totally cluttered and almost rhythmically unhinged. Obviously there's no lack of congas in disco, house, and the like, but I'm looking for the most ridiculous extended rattlejams, particularly in the breakdowns or dub versions, or the cleanest, grooviest, trackiest rhythms made of same elements... My picks so far:

* Max 404, "She Spelled Sex" off Dirty Disco Vol 1 (Eskimo)
* H3öH (Hafler Trio), B-side (Ash 1.3)
* Lola/Arthur Russell, "Wax the Van (Jon's Dub)" (Jump Street)
* Schaeben/Geiger, "Really Real," Tomba EP (Firm)
* Raw Sex (N. Cherry/J. Blocker/G. Oban), "Give Sheep a Chance (Wooly Version)" (Mango)

I know my criteria are a little vague but it's probably more interesting that way...
